I'm afraid I don't think this is the right solution. We only want to save the stash if there are conflicts when we apply it - that is why MERGE_AUTOSTASH is deleted before we do the reset - we want to prevent remove_branch_state() from saving it. If the stash applies cleanly then we should not save it. If the reset fails then we should keep MERGE_AUTOSTASH along with the other merge state files rather than saving the stash (which is actually what happens after this patch because cmd_reset() dies before it calls remove_branch_state()). I think the solution is probably to stop calling builtin/reset.c:cmd_reset() and instead extend reset.c:reset_working_tree()[1] to do a "merge" reset by adding a "RESET_WORKING_TREE_MERGE" flag (or possibly we want to remove RESET_WORKTING_TREE_HARD from the flags and add a reset_mode member). Then we can call struct reset_working_tree opts = { .flags = RESET_WORKING_TREE_MERGE; }; if (reset_working_tree(the_repository, &opts)) die(_("could not reset index and working tree")); apply_autostash_ref(...); /* apply the stash */ remove_branch_state(...); /* remove merge state */ So we only delete MERGE_AUTOSTASH after a successful reset and we only save the stash if it applies with conflicts.
